Data processing method and device, and electronic equipment
A data processing and data set technology, applied in the computer field, can solve problems such as low data processing efficiency, and achieve the effects of reducing resource consumption, reducing data delay, and improving data processing efficiency
- Summary
- Abstract
- Description
- Claims
- Application Information
AI Technical Summary
Problems solved by technology
Method used
Image
Examples
Embodiment 1
[0020] Such as figure 1 As shown, the embodiment of the present invention provides a data processing method. The execution subject of the method may be a server, and the server may be an independent server or a server cluster composed of multiple servers. The method specifically may include the following steps:
[0021] In S102, based on a preset data interface, target data for a target service is collected.
[0022] Wherein, the target service may be any mobile communication service, the target data may include signaling data and / or user plane data for the target service, and the preset data interface may be any data interface that can obtain the target data, for example, preset data The interface may include a Kafka data interface, a preset file transfer protocol (File Transfer Protocol, FTP) interface, a WebService interface, and the like.
[0023] Among them, the terminal electronic device can be any electronic device held by the on-site staff and used to collect the bas...
Embodiment 2
[0041] Such as figure 2 As shown, the embodiment of the present invention provides a data processing method. The execution subject of the method may be a server, and the server may be an independent server or a server cluster composed of multiple servers. The method specifically may include the following steps:
[0042] In S202, the queue capacity of the lock-free queue is obtained, and based on the queue capacity, target data for the target service is collected through a preset data interface.
[0043] In the implementation, the target data is collected through the queue capacity of the lock-free queue, which can reduce the data interaction time and avoid the data waiting problem caused by the data volume of the target data being greater than the queue capacity of the lock-free queue.
[0044] A data collection thread can be defined, which is used to collect the target data for the target business through the preset data interface.
[0045] The lock-free queue can be used ...
Embodiment 3
[0103] The above is the data processing method provided by the embodiment of the present invention. Based on the same idea, the embodiment of the present invention also provides a data processing device, such as image 3 shown.
[0104] The data processing device includes: a data acquisition module 301, a data input module 302, a data set acquisition module 303 and a data processing module 304, wherein:
[0105] A data collection module 301, configured to collect target data for a target service based on a preset data interface, where the target data includes signaling data and / or user plane data for the target service;
[0106] The data input module 302 is configured to put the target data into a preset lock-free queue, and classify the target data based on preset classification rules and data characteristics of the target data to obtain multiple classified data sets , the lock-free queue is a queue constructed based on a ring array and does not need to be locked;
[0107] ...
PUM
Login to View More Abstract
Description
Claims
Application Information
Login to View More 


